This is a wristwatch that speaks the current time aloud in German when you press a button, with an optional hourly time announcement you can turn on or off. It's designed for someone with low vision or blindness who needs a quick, audible way to check the time without relying on a visual display. You get a complete, ready-to-use watch — battery is included, and it works straight out of the box with no pairing or setup required. One thing to note: despite the product name saying 'German,' the vendor reference indicates the voice is actually Italian, so confirm the announced language matches your needs before purchasing.

What Setup Looks Like

  • Out of the box
    1. Install the included CR2025 battery if not pre-installed.
    2. Set the time using the watch's buttons.
    3. Press the main button to hear the time announced aloud.
